3d modeler vs web graphic designer

The differences between 3d modelers and web graphic designers can be seen in a few details. Each job has different responsibilities and duties. While it typically takes 1-2 years to become a 3d modeler, becoming a web graphic designer takes usually requires 6-12 months. Additionally, a 3d modeler has an average salary of $75,946, which is higher than the $52,574 average annual salary of a web graphic designer.

The top three skills for a 3d modeler include animation, adobe photoshop and visualization. The most important skills for a web graphic designer are graphic design, wordpress, and HTML.

What does a 3d modeler do?

A 3D modeler is responsible for designing project models by utilizing various software applications and computer tools to represent high-quality digital content that would help the team and clients visualize the object. 3D modelers work closely with the design team to evaluate ideas and identify its feasibility scope on an enhanced digital view, giving them the ability to adjust and revise structures as needed. A 3D modeler must have excellent technical and critical-thinking skills to understand the clients' specifications and recommend solutions through graphics analysis.

What does a web graphic designer do?

A web graphic designer specializes in the aesthetics and functionality of a web platform, software, and other applications. They are primarily responsible for building a platform that adheres to the subject's purpose and the client's preferred theme while prioritizing an easy-to-use and navigate interface. They must conduct regular testing and maintenance on the platform to ensure its efficiency and significance to the brand involved. Furthermore, a web graphic designer may work independently or work for a company, usually within a team setting.
